That Computer Shopper article examines the ATI Mach64, the Matrox, The
#9GXE 64, and the Diamont Stealth 64. Of those 4 cards, they said the
fastest DOS perfoemance was with the Diamond Stealth -- in both PCI and
VLB , with the VLB taking the lead in DOS performance on all cards. "In
our tests using ID software's DOOM!, driving the Diamond card through the
virtual 3D landscape was stunningly smooth."Our DOOM! tests confirmed the
scores, and animation chunked across the screen with all the grace of a
bulldozer on a skating rink [on the Matrox MGA ULT+].
The magazines now appear to be using DOOM! as a new DOS benchmark test
-- and well they should since it is the single most important piece of DOS
software yet to be conceived.
DOS VGA VIDEO SCORE [computer shopper]
ATI GPT PCI = 4200
VLB = 5300
Diamond Stealth 64 PCI = 6000
VLB = 6400
Matrox MGA Ult+ PCI = 600
VLB = 600
#9 GXE Pro 64 PCI = 5900
VLB = N/A
